What's that you can hear? High-pitched voices? The rapid pattering of little feet? A palpable sense of excitement? It can only be Legoland California. This family-friendly theme park is one of Carlsbad's most popular attractions, featuring entertainment, rides, and even its own water park and aquarium. If you're around between March and May, the Flower Fields at Carlsbad Ranch are a particularly lovely part of the Carlsbad vacation rental experience, with multi colored fields, rose gardens, and special seasonal events. There are museums too, including the Miniature Engineering Craftsmanship Museum and the Carlsbad Barrio and Museum.

As weather goes, it doesn't come much better than the climate in this part of California. Summers round here are hot and dry, so you can be fairly certain your Legoland trip isn't going to be a washout. It rarely gets too hot, thanks to those cool breezes blowing in off the Pacific, but if it does, the ocean's right there, after all. Winter is also a decent option for a Carlsbad vacation rental. The weather's still pretty mild, without too much rain, though you might get a bit of fog coming in from time to time.
If the attractions and the upscale vibe make Carlsbad a winner in the vacation destination stakes, then the setting isn't bad either. The city is full of open spaces, including lakes, parks, ranches, and hills. The standout feature of the area, though, is its spectacular Pacific coast. With 7 miles of rocky coastline and sandy beaches, there's something for everyone, whether you're looking for a secluded spot to laze in the sun or some serious waves to test your mettle against. Many of the beaches in this part of San Diego County are protected, making them havens for wildlife.
The nearest airport is in San Diego Intl. Airport (SAN), located 30.7 mi (49.5 km) from the city center. If you can't find a flight that works for your travel itinerary, you might consider flying into Carlsbad, CA (CLD-McClellan-Palomar), which is 4.9 mi (7.8 km) away.
If you're traveling by train, make your way to Carlsbad Village Station or Carlsbad Poinsettia Station to see more of the city.
Carlsbad is one of the best destinations for a family trip. Vacation homes are available near places like Miniland USA, an amusement park with thrill rides, kiddie rides, and games, and Batiquitos Lagoon, an ecological reserve with a nature center and hiking trails. Kids will also like SEA LIFE Aquarium, a family-friendly marine facility with thousands of sea creatures and interactive exhibits.
Carlsbad boasts numerous romantic locations for a couple’s retreat. Vacation homes can be found near places like San Elijo Lagoon, a nature reserve with miles of trails through a lagoon teeming with wildlife, and the Flower Fields, a seasonal park with acres of colorful flowers and walking paths. You could also visit Leo Carrillo Ranch History Park, a historic park in a canyon with peacocks, birds of paradise, and other unique flora and fauna.
